Sunday, Taylor Swift released her music video for her song “Delicate” after winning female artist of the year at the iHeartRadio Music Awards. “Delicate” is the fourth single off of her new album “Reputation” and gives fans a real step into her life. This is definitely one of the densest songs in terms of lyrics. One of the best lyrics is “My reputation’s never been worse so you must like me for me”.

Recently, we’ve seen Taylor step out of the spotlight- and this music video is a great depiction of that. She’s avoided all interviews after her album dropped and her social media is only filled with album promotion. The music video begins with dozens of cameras in her face and within that crowd, someone slips her a note.

She then walks into a fancy lobby and everyone turns and stares at her as she walks by. Taylor tries to stop and take pictures with fans but people start to grab her and her security team is on top of her every move. The coolest part of this music video is when she all of a sudden becomes invisible. She dances throughout the rest of the music video (not the greatest dancing but it’s Taylor Swift, so it’s fine.). The video ends with her at a bar holding the piece of paper from the beginning of the music video and she’s visible again and everyone turns and looks at her.

So, let’s discuss the message of the video. Even though she is one of the most popular celebrities it still has its drawbacks. It’s super overwhelming for her. The minute she becomes invisible she is able to be herself and dance like no one’s watching. This goes to show that although right now she’s kind of gone away from the spotlight she’s doing great (and as a swiftie, this music video was amazing.)
